Aer Lingus Approves SENTRY FlightSafe for Use on Aircraft
DALLAS --(Business Wire)--
Aer Lingus, the national airline of Ireland, announced today the
approval for the carriage of the SENTRY 400 FlightSafe® device. Aer
Lingus Cargo is now accepting consignments that contain the SENTRY
device. The device enables customers to GPS track and monitor conditions
of their cargo throughout the entire transport process. This option
enables greater collaboration and proactive response effort between Aer
Lingus Cargo, freight forwarders, and shippers. The result is a highly
effective and near real-time view of the cargo with the option of
tailored alerts while the consignment is in transit.
"GPS tracking and data gathering of consignments in transit is
increasing in importance for many of Aer Lingus Cargo's Customers,
particularly pharmaceutical manufacturers. We are very pleased to have
worked with OnAsset (News - Alert) to gain the approval for the SENTRY device as a very
effective solution," says Peter O'Neill, Director of Cargo. "The device
has gone through extensive tests prior to acceptance by the Irish
Aviation Authority (IAA) which has given Aer Lingus approval for the
SENTRY device under rules for Carriage of Approved Tracking Devices on
its Airbus A330 and A320 aircraft. We see this technology as an ideal
solution to provide important information about cargo as quickly as
posible whilst complying with the strict legislation covering the use
of electronic devices on board aircraft."
"Approval for carriage of the device from Aer Lingus is great news for
OnAsset," says Adam Crossno, President and CEO of OnAsset Intelligence.
"Routes flown by Aer Lingus Cargo are important to our customers and we
are excited to extend the tracking device network to include new flight
services."
The SENTRY 400 FlightSafe is a tracking device that provides GPS
location, light, temperature, humidity, and vibration data transmitted
on the ground using the worldwide GSM / GPRS wireless network. The
device is small in size and can be easily placed with handheld packages,
palletized or containerized freight. SENTRY FlightSafe is manufactured
by Irving, TX, firm, OnAsset Intelligence. The company holds a patent
for automatic radio off mode during flight.

About Aer Lingus
Aer Lingus' strategy is to carry cargo on both long haul and short haul
routes using the available hold capacity of the passenger aircraft
fleet. Our A330 aircraft operate to Boston, Chicago, New York and
Orlando airports, carrying up to 20 tonnes of freight. Working with our
air and land partners Aer Lingus Cargo provides links to over 50 onwards
destinations in the USA and Canada.
Our fully containerized A320 aircraft serving the European network carry
up to 4 tonnes of freight.
Aer Lingus Cargo generated revenues of €43.0m in 2011.
